About

Peter Roth is a commercial real estate attorney with more than 32 years of legal experience, practicing at Allen Matkins Leck Gamble Mallory & Natsis LLP in Los Angeles, CA. He earned a B.A. from Duke University in 1990 and a J.D. from Duke University School of Law in 1993. He has been admitted to the California Bar since 1993. His practice encompasses commercial real estate and real estate,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
